Output 101d56151f1f262456a6cac04078d871bfe7cde6366123dda9433a57a91c2f8d:3

value
34000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09695c874f7587aaeb9792452b83af001870672f OP_EQUAL
address
32YnDupBrf4CXMbbwbzGUoshRMx4SGquZN
transaction
101d56151f1f262456a6cac04078d871bfe7cde6366123dda9433a57a91c2f8d
spent
true